Are All Shower Arms The Same. Simply put, a shower arm is the curved metal pipe that connects your shower head to the water supply in your wall. However, most standard shower heads will fit most standard shower fixtures. The thread size of a shower head is determined by the diameter of the tubing, not the size of the faceplate. A shower head with a smaller diameter can still fit into an existing shower arm, and the threading will be similar to one that is larger in diameter, so there’s no need to change it. A shower arm can be anywhere from three to eighteen inches long. Are all shower arms the same size? No, not all shower arms are the same. A shower arm is a short pipe, typically.5” in diameter, that connects between the showerhead and the water line behind the wall. Shower arms come in a variety of shapes, sizes, and styles to suit a variety of. But overall, most shower heads are universal and will fit your shower arm. Are all shower arms the same? However, products longer than twelve inches are uncommon, and they all use the same thread size of ½ inch. Shower arms may require replacement for several reasons, including installing a new showerhead, showing signs of rust and corrosion, or simply due to the person’s height or people who plan on using the shower stall.
